Tour Overview and Pricing

Baltimore: Morning and Sunset Sailing Tour - Tour Overview and Pricing

Discover the beauty of Baltimore from the water with a captivating morning or sunset sailing tour. Offered at an accessible price starting from $500.00 for a group of up to six participants, these 2.5-hour excursions provide an unforgettable experience.

Guests can enjoy a stress-free booking process, with options for free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ance and a "reserve now, pay later" feature. The tour begins at 951 Fell St, Henderson’s Wharf at Fells Point, allowing easy access to Baltimore’s iconic sights.

Whether it’s a romantic outing or a fun day with friends, this sailing adventure promises scenic views and memorable moments. With flexible pricing and convenient options, it’s perfect for any occasion.

Experience on the Water

Baltimore: Morning and Sunset Sailing Tour - Experience on the Water

What can be more enchanting than sailing through the historic waters of Baltimore aboard the stunning 46-foot sloop, Reverie?

Guests aboard Reverie enjoy an intimate experience, accommodating up to six participants for a cozy outing. The trip includes complimentary Prosecco and a delightful cheese board, enhancing the sailing experience.

With a full salon and two bathrooms, comfort is prioritized, making it easy to relax as the wind fills the sails. Safety is paramount, with life jackets provided and an MSC Licensed Captain navigating the waters.

Whether it’s the vibrant morning sun or the mesmerizing sunset, guests find themselves captivated by the beauty of Baltimore’s skyline and the tranquility of the water, creating unforgettable memories.

Preparing for Your Tour

Baltimore: Morning and Sunset Sailing Tour - Preparing for Your Tour

Typically, guests should prepare in advance to ensure a smooth and enjoyable sailing experience.

First, they should check the weather forecast, as conditions can change quickly on the water. Dressing in layers is advisable; it keeps everyone comfortable regardless of temperature fluctuations. Guests might also want to bring sunglasses, sunscreen, and a hat to protect against the sun.

For those planning to capture memories, a camera or smartphone is a must. It’s wise to arrive at the departure point, 951 Fell St, Henderson’s Wharf, a bit early to settle in and enjoy the atmosphere.

Lastly, guests should confirm their reservation details and be aware of the cancellation policy for added peace of mind. Preparation ensures a memorable time on the water.
